Hello everyone.im new to the site and have a question for u pros. I have a 61 impala ht with a stock 283 4 bl edelbrock carb. Had the car for a few months now and all of a sudden its overheating. Has a 7 blade flexalite fan no clutch, a 160 stat with 2 holes in the flange. On the freeway it runs around 215ish but in traffic it is at 230! It had some wispy smoke coming out of the filler tube and upon insp i found out it had no pcv so i ran one from the dt to the back of the carb and installed a 14 in. auxilary fan in front of the rad.it takes longer to over heat but eventually gets up to 230 in park. No water in oil and still runs like a hog. Any ideas why its overheating?????Im at a loss here on wut to do.

if its overheating in park the issue is air flow through the rad or coolant flow through the rad. are any fan shrouds missing? Anything blocking air flow through the rad....clogged fins?
with the cap off and the stat open...is there good flow past the rad cap opening?
